Using LogViewerSearching in LogViewerAfter you make a search rule, you can use it to search the data shown in LogViewer.1 Use the Log Type drop-down list to select which type of log messages appears in the window.2 Use the Display Results drop-down list to select the method to show the results of the search. Theoptions are:- Highlight in main window — The LogViewer window shows the same log message set, butchanges the color of log messages that match the criteria. Use the F3 key to move throughspecified entries.- Main window — Only the log messages that match the search criteria appear in the primaryLogViewer window.- New window - A new window opens to show log messages that match the search criteria.3 Select from the option:- Match any — Show log messages that match any of the search criteria.- Match all — Show only log messages that match all of the search criteria.4 Click OK to start the search.Viewing the current log file in LogViewerYou can open the current log file in LogViewer to examine the logs as they are written to the log file.LogViewer automatically updates its display with new log messages at 15-second intervals. If you have aLogViewer search window open with the current log file, it also updates every 15 seconds.Copying LogViewer dataYou can copy log file data from LogViewer to a different tool. Use copy to move specified log messagesto a different tool.1 Select the log messages to copy.Use the Shift key to select a group of entries. Use the Ctrl key to select more than one entry.2 Select Edit > Copy.3 Paste the data into any text editor.94 <strong>WatchGuard</strong> System Manager
